# REMOTE SHELL ({sc-spring-boot-actuator}/autoconfigure/ShellProperties.{sc-ext}[ShellProperties])
management.shell.auth.type=simple # Authentication type. Auto-detected according to the environment.
management.shell.auth.jaas.domain=my-domain # JAAS domain.
management.shell.auth.key.path= # Path to the authentication key. This should point to a valid ".pem" file.
management.shell.auth.simple.user.name=user # Login user.
management.shell.auth.simple.user.password= # Login password.
management.shell.auth.spring.roles=ADMIN # Comma-separated list of required roles to login to the CRaSH console.
management.shell.command-path-patterns=classpath*:/commands/**,classpath*:/crash/commands/** # Patterns to use to look for commands.
management.shell.command-refresh-interval=-1 # Scan for changes and update the command if necessary (in seconds).
management.shell.config-path-patterns=classpath*:/crash/* # Patterns to use to look for configurations.
management.shell.disabled-commands=jpa*,jdbc*,jndi* # Comma-separated list of commands to disable.
management.shell.disabled-plugins= # Comma-separated list of plugins to disable. Certain plugins are disabled by default based on the environment.
management.shell.ssh.auth-timeout = # Number of milliseconds after user will be prompted to login again.
management.shell.ssh.enabled=true # Enable CRaSH SSH support.
management.shell.ssh.idle-timeout = # Number of milliseconds after which unused connections are closed.
management.shell.ssh.key-path= # Path to the SSH server key.
management.shell.ssh.port=2000 # SSH port.
management.shell.telnet.enabled=false # Enable CRaSH telnet support. Enabled by default if the TelnetPlugin is available.
management.shell.telnet.port=5000 # Telnet port.
